ورود

View Full Version : کدام گزینه بهتر است؟ جدول های بزرگتر و جوین کمتر یا جداول کوچکتر با Join بیشتر



user1389
دوشنبه 23 دی 1392, 08:16 صبح
با سلام خدمت همه بر و بچ برنامه نویس.ارگ
وقتی که جداول خیلی بزرگ نیستند اما ماهیتا با هم فرق می کنند مثلا (سازمان, شغل, محل کار) بهتره کدام گزینه رو رعایت کنیم؟
1- بگذاریم اطلاعاتشون کنار هم توی یک جدول باشند.
2- جدول رو بشکنیم و بین جداول جدید ارتباط برقرار کنیم؟
ضمنا توسعه برنامه و تعداد زیاد رکورد ها خیلی مهمه.
ممنون.

Aalibeigi
دوشنبه 23 دی 1392, 09:10 صبح
sلام
زیاد فرقی نمیکنه
اما تو پایگاه داده های خیلی بزرگ میگن بهتره join کمتری استفاده بشه و تا حد امکان جدول های واسط وجود داشته باشن.
و البته که تو پایگاه داده ای که خیلی بزرگ شده بهتره چند تا جدول بهینه شده وکوچک داشته باشی تا یه جدول بزرگ.
مباحث بهینه سازی پایگاه داده ها رو هم که تو درس پایگاه داده ها خوندین انشاال...
اما اگه پایگاه دادت از 1 هزار میلیون کمتر رکورد داره یه جدول باشه خودت راحت تری - سلکت هات راحت تر هستن-.